Fitting into the Window

“I’ve always known,” says Brian Schaadt, “that the reason for successful flights is never due to my inherent skill or knowledge. It is the Lord who empowers and equips me for each flight I do here.”

Brian really banked on the Lord’s power as he thought through some upcoming flights.

First, he had to fly the R66 helicopter from Luzon island to another region of the Philippines. From there, he’d do some longs flights out to a small, lonely island in the middle of the ocean where church planters are preparing to teach sometime this year.

Because of schedules of various passengers, the flights were boxed into a limited window of opportunity. On top of that, it was rainy season. He’d also be over open ocean much of the time, where he couldn’t just land and wait out the storm. And refueling options would be few.

All in all, things started to feel stressful to Brian. So he sent out a plea for prayer.

God answered! In the end, it was “one of the more adventurous trips I’ve had,” said Brian. “It was every bit as difficult as I anticipated – with many unplanned stops and uncertainty of where we would sleep. But seeing how the Lord worked through it turned it into an experience I wouldn’t have traded – now that it’s over, that is.”

In one instance, he had just come off the open sea, back over land. “There was a wall of rain and white-out conditions as far as I could see,” he said. Just then, God provided a small airstrip to put down on before the worst of it hit.

When the rain stopped, Brian wanted to take off and “have a look” to assess the situation. But his fuel reserves were too low to waste on a “test” flight.

Just then, two little planes flew over, coming from the direction he wanted to go. He connected by radio and got the needed weather report!

“I could see the Lord taking good care of things every step of the way,” says Brian. Everyone got where they needed to go, with no cancellations or major changes of plans.
